]> git.ipfire.org Git - thirdparty/vala.git/commitdiff
codegen: No need to retrieve CodeContext.save_csources inside loop
authorRico Tzschichholz <ricotz@ubuntu.com>
Tue, 19 Mar 2019 12:43:30 +0000 (13:43 +0100)
committerRico Tzschichholz <ricotz@ubuntu.com>
Tue, 19 Mar 2019 12:57:22 +0000 (13:57 +0100)
codegen/valaccodecompiler.vala

index 76549c94c9a3b16c31e44f3e3fb3cb0f64b51ac6..b56af71a5e6bbfc32dbde062919f037fdb287a86 100644 (file)
@@ -108,9 +108,9 @@ public class Vala.CCodeCompiler {
                }
 
                /* remove generated C source and header files */
-               foreach (SourceFile file in source_files) {
-                       if (file.file_type == SourceFileType.SOURCE) {
-                               if (!context.save_csources) {
+               if (!context.save_csources) {
+                       foreach (SourceFile file in source_files) {
+                               if (file.file_type == SourceFileType.SOURCE) {
                                        FileUtils.unlink (file.get_csource_filename ());
                                }
                        }